Skanska to build arts facility in the U.S. for USD 216 M, approximately SEK 1.7 billion

Skanska has been selected as the construction manager for a new arts facility for a client in the U.S. The contract amount is USD 216 M, approximately SEK 1.7 billion, which has been included in the order bookings for the fourth quarter.

The facility will comprise 200,000 square feet and work on the project began late last year. It will incorporate green design concepts to achieve LEED® certification from the United States Green Building Council. Skanska USA Building is a leading national and local provider of construction, pre-construction consulting, general contracting and design-build services. The company also provides validation services to clients in the pharmaceutical industry. Clients represent a broad range of U.S. industries, including science and technology, healthcare, education, high-tech, aviation, transportation and sports and entertainment. The business unit is headquartered in Parsippany, New Jersey and has approximately 3,500 employees. Sales in 2008 amounted to about SEK 30.3 billion.
